No, coal is not made out of crude oil. Coal is a solid fossil fuel that is formed from the remains of plants that lived millions of years ago, while crude oil is a liquid fossil fuel formed from the remains of marine plants and animals.
No, petroleum is not made of coal and oil. Petroleum is a liquid mixture of hydrocarbons that is naturally occurring in the Earth's crust. It is formed from the remains of ancient marine organisms that have been subjected to heat and pressure over millions of years. Coal is a solid fossil fuel formed from plant remains, while oil, also known as crude oil, is another liquid hydrocarbon mixture that is also formed from organic matter.
Coal and oil are not considered minerals because they are organic substances derived from decaying plant and animal matter (organic compounds). Minerals are inorganic substances with a crystalline structure, whereas coal and oil are formed through biological processes. Additionally, coal and oil are made up of complex combinations of carbon, hydrogen, and other elements, while minerals are typically composed of one or more naturally occurring chemical elements.
Coal produces more carbon dioxide when burnt compared to oil. This is because coal contains a higher carbon content than oil. When coal is burned, it releases more carbon dioxide per unit of energy generated compared to oil.
Yes, coal and oil both contain carbon. Coal is primarily made up of carbon with varying amounts of other elements like hydrogen, sulfur, and oxygen. Oil, also known as petroleum, is a complex mixture of hydrocarbons mainly composed of carbon and hydrogen.
